释义 | > as lemmassocket-money socket-money n. slang see quots. and sense 4b. ΘΚΠ society > trade and finance > fees and taxes > illegal payment or exaction > [noun] > extorted from married man socket-money1699 socket1818 1699 B. E. New Dict. Canting Crew Socket-money, Demanded and Spent upon Marriage. 1770 T. Bridges Burlesque Transl. Homer I. iii. 141 We must likewise come upon ye By way of costs for socket-money. 1785 F. Grose Classical Dict. Vulgar Tongue Socket money, a whore's fee, or hire, also money paid for a treat, by a married man caught in an intrigue. 1864 J. C. Hotten Slang Dict. (new ed.) Socket-money, money extorted by threats of exposure. < as lemmas |
